The Secrets of Shinnecock Hills: Unraveling the Gnarliest U.S. Open Test (2026)

Shinnecock Hills Golf Club, a 135-year-old masterpiece, presents a formidable challenge for the U.S. Open, renowned for its unpredictable wind patterns and triangular layout. This course, designed by William Flynn, is a testament to his genius, forcing players to confront nature's unpredictability. The triangular formation of holes, strategically positioned to pit golfers against the prevailing southwest wind, demands heightened focus and strategic thinking. Flynn's design, inspired by Merion's unpredictable winds, showcases his foresight in addressing the evolving distance problem in golf. The course's fairways create optical illusions, treacherous bunkers, and greens designed to repel balls, making every shot a test of skill and strategy. The 2018 U.S. Open drama highlighted the fine line between challenge and chaos, as the USGA struggled to manage the course's speed and wind conditions. Despite the challenges, Shinnecock's timeless appeal lies in its ability to test the best players, offering a unique and demanding experience that golf enthusiasts worldwide admire.
